The Supply Chain Specialist initiates the purchase of goods and services and monitors and expedites open orders and invoice discrepancies. Maintains item file. Maintains and delivers supplies as needed, ensuring timeliness and accuracy. Receives all product into the site via the inventory management system, appropriately documents and directs delivery of all parcels. **Job Description:** **Job Responsibilities:** 1. Create, confirm, and expedite all purchase orders for assigned departments. Assist end users with sourcing of products and services. Verify electronic requisitions for proper approvals. Maintain item files, including vendor and distributor pricing, terms and conditions. 2. Resolve all issues of receipts, returns, quality (fitness for use) or invoicing issues for purchase orders. 3. Maintain and monitor all implants and supplies. Monitor stock levels and anticipate supply needs to prevent shortages and ensure readiness for surgical procedures. 4. Deliver surgical supplies to the operating rooms as needed, ensuring timeliness and accuracy. Restock and organize operating room supplies to maintain proper inventory levels and accessibility. 5. Receive incoming shipments, ensuring they match purchase orders and packing lists. Inspect items for quality, accuracy, and compliance with hospital standards. Identify and report any damaged, expired, or recalled items. 6. Collaborate with suppliers and delivery personnel to ensure smooth and timely deliveries. 7. Accurately document all inventory-related activities, including surgical supply usage. 8. Provide top level customer service to all internal and external customers in regards to supply requests, delivery requirements, problem resolution, and general information inquiries. 9. Establish and maintain professional working relationships with vendors and colleagues. 10. Support the Materials Manager in maintaining daily Supply Chain needs for facility. 11. Collaborate with Finance and Billing teams to ensure complete and accurate billing for each case. **Job Qualifications:** 1. HS Diploma or GED. 2. 1 - 3 years of experience. 3.
